Moinhos Shopping is a 1.6 MW gas-fired power plant in Brazil, commissioned in 2008. Ranked #132 of 146 gas plants in Brazil, it accounts for 0.01% of the country's total gas capacity of 27,781 MW. The largest gas plant in Brazil is Porto de Sergipe I Thermoelectric Plant at 1,551 MW, making Moinhos Shopping 968.1 times smaller. Nearby plants include CMPC (Antiga Aracruz Unidade Guaíba) (250.994 MW, Biomass), Canoas Power Plant (249 MW, Gas), and Sepé Tiaraju (Antiga Canoas) (248.572 MW, Gas). The facility is situated in Rio Grande do Sul, approximately 30 km from Porto Alegre.
